I want to perform task almost as in the FAQ #1
<https://salilab.org/modeller/FAQ.html#1>: I have two separate proteins,
and want to receive one -- where these two are joined by the [G4S]n
linker. The major difference from the example in FAQ that I have the
exact orientation of both domains (they are docked onto the same
receptor at different sites), and I want them to be prohibited from
movement. The common protocol moves the downstream domain so it changes
its position and orientation, but I have to basically "freeze" the both
domains, allowing the linker to fullfill the space between them.
Either merge the two domains into one PDB file and treat them as a
single template with two chains (in which case Modeller will generate
inter-chain restraints and keep the input orientation), or deselect
those two domains so that Modeller does not refine them, as per
https://salilab.org/modeller/9.23/manual/node23.html
